Ecological Pyramids
An ecological pyramid (or trophic pyramid) is a graphical representation designed to show the biomass or productivity at each trophic level in a given ecosystem. Biomass pyramids show the abundance or biomass of organisms at each trophic level, while productivity pyramids show the production or turnover in biomass. NYCOM White Coat Ceremony 2011
The White Coat Ceremony marks the transition that medical students make when they complete their classroom education and begin their clinical training. New York Institute of Technology (NYIT), New York College of Osteopathic Medicine (NYCOM).

Boiler Bytes: Adventures in Computer Science Camp
The 2011 Adventures in Computer Science Summer Camp for students entering grades 6-8 is scheduled for June 19-24 at Purdue University. The camp will take an in-depth look at computer science concepts such as programming and robotics and how they are used every day to make a difference in our world.
